Step-by-Step Approach to Solving AB Frq Questions
Understanding how to solve AB Frq questions effectively requires a structured approach. Here’s a step-by-step guide to help you navigate through the challenges:
Step 1: Read the Question Carefully
The first step in solving any AP Calculus question is to thoroughly read the problem. Pay attention to keywords such as “find the derivative,” “integrate,” or “analyze the behavior.” Misinterpreting the question can lead to incorrect answers.
For example, if a question asks for the rate of change of a function, it’s crucial to identify whether you need to find the derivative or analyze the slope of a tangent line.
Step 2: Identify the Required Concepts
Once you understand the question, the next step is to determine which calculus concepts are relevant. This involves recalling the appropriate formulas and theorems.
For instance, if the question involves finding the maximum value of a function, you’ll need to use the first or second derivative test. Similarly, for integration, you may need to apply substitution or integration by parts.
Step 3: Apply the Correct Method
After identifying the concepts, apply the correct method to solve the problem. This may involve:
- Graphical Analysis: Drawing graphs to visualize the behavior of the function.
- Algebraic Manipulation: Simplifying expressions to make calculations easier.
- Calculation Techniques: Using specific formulas to derive the solution.
It’s important to stay organized and follow a logical sequence of steps to ensure accuracy.
Step 4: Verify Your Answer
After arriving at a solution, it’s wise to double-check your work. This involves:
- Rechecking Calculations: Ensure that all computations are correct.
- Cross-Referencing: Compare your answer with those provided in the answer key or with previous problems you’ve solved.
Verification not only helps in identifying errors but also builds confidence in your problem-solving abilities.
Step 5: Review and Learn from Mistakes
If you encounter a question you didn’t get right, take the time to analyze your approach. Understanding where you went wrong can be just as valuable as knowing the correct answer. This process helps reinforce your learning and prevents similar mistakes in the future.
